В этом посте я хочу поговорить о том, как PWA меняют правила игры в мире SEO. Не абстрактно — а по-настоящему. На своём опыте знаю: чтобы сайт работал, его сначала должны найти. А чтобы нашли — он должен грузиться быстро, выглядеть аккуратно и отвечать на запросы пользователя с первой секунды. Именно поэтому я уже давно делаю ставку на Progressive Web Apps. Расскажу, почему это важно и как использовать в своих проектах.
Что такое PWA
Про PWA я услышала от своего фронтендера весной. Мы сидели в переговорке, запускали новый образовательный проект, и он вдруг говорит:
— А давай соберем PWA? Это будет как сайт, но можно будет ставить на телефон, работать офлайн и всё летать будет.
И правда: Progressive Web Apps — это гибрид сайта и мобильного приложения. Внешне — обычный сайт, а по ощущениям — как будто открыл App. Грузится моментально, работает даже офлайн. И можно установить себе на экран, не заходя в App Store.
В основе технологий — Service Worker, который управляет кэшем, перехватывает запросы. А ещё web app manifest — JSON-файл с параметрами установки: иконка, цвета, имя. Ещё один плюс — адаптация под любое устройство: от Galaxy до старенького ноутбука.
В России такие подходы не новость. Посмотрите, как работает Яндекс.Маркет — это чистый PWA. Грузится быстро даже на слабом интернете, и видно, что над UX труда вложили немало (источник).
PWA и SEO: основные аспекты влияния
Зачем весь этот танец с PWA? Ради SEO. Потому что Google сейчас обращает больше внимания на поведенческие сигналы — user experience, скорость, стабильность. Именно в этом PWA и сильны.
UX-сигналы важны: сколько человек провёл на сайте, насколько далеко пролистал, вернулся ли он потом. У PWA эти метрики лучше просто потому, что работать с ними приятнее. AliExpress после внедрения PWA увеличил iOS-конверсии на 82%. Это не цифры с потолка.
Скорость загрузки тоже решает. Когда страницы открываются в два раза быстрее, это не может не сказаться на позициях. Исследования подтверждают: PWA в среднем грузятся на 40% быстрее обычных сайтов.
И главное — мобильная оптимизация. Google шёл к Mobile-First лет пять. Сейчас отдаёт приоритет мобильным версиям. А PWA — это изначально мобильный подход, на котором держится весь продукт.
Indexability PWA: как сделать приложение доступным для поисковиков
Но есть нюанс. Часто страницы PWA собираются на клиенте — через JavaScript. А поиск… ну он ещё не везде настолько умен, чтобы дождаться этого рендеринга. Вот тут и важно грамотно настроить indexability.
Из проверенного:
- Делаем SSR или pre-rendering — чтобы отдать на вход поисковику уже готовый HTML.
- Следим за мета-тегами, заголовками, микроразметкой.
- Подключаем sitemap, прописываем robots.txt.
- И обязательно гоним инспекцию через Google Search Console с URL Inspection API.
У меня в проекте был случай: после перевода блога на SSR за три месяца охват по ключевым фразам вырос на 30%. Упал bounce rate, улучшилось удержание. Всё потому, что контент наконец стали нормально индексировать.
SSR vs CSR: что выбрать для SEO
Client-Side Rendering — не зло. У него есть плюсы, особенно для сложных интерфейсов. Но если говорить о SEO — выбор очевиден. SSR даёт HTML сразу. Боту ничего ждать не нужно. Он видит весь контент — заголовки, тексты, ссылки.
Компании вроде AliExpress используют гибридные решения — часть страниц SSR, часть CSR. Для нас, в СНГ, идеально подходить к этому точно: где контент — SSR, где личный кабинет и интерактив — CSR.
Хорошая альтернатива — Next.js. Он даёт гибкость и не ломает SEO.
Кэширование в PWA и его влияние на SEO
Нечасто говорят: кэш влияет на SEO. Но влияет. Чем быстрее грузится страница — тем меньше отказов. Чем стабильнее работает сайт — тем выше шанс, что пользователь останется.
Service Workers берут на себя всё: кэшируют статику, обновляют данные в фоне, работают по стратегиям — кеш-сначала или сеть-сначала. Главное — не перекэшировать. Пару раз мы так кэшировали устаревшие заголовки, что потом вручную чистили всё.
Один образовательный проект, с которым мы работали, после внедрения стратегического кэширования уменьшил время загрузки с 4 до 2 секунд. Organics вырос на 18% за два месяца. Просто потому, что сайт начал дышать.
UX-сигналы в SEO: как помочь им через PWA
Google любит, когда всё удобно. Главное — Core Web Vitals:
- LCP: насколько быстро появляется главный блок;
- FID: как быстро система реагирует на первый клик;
- CLS: не скачет ли контент при загрузке.
PWA тут — как хороший бариста. Всё делаешь быстро и точно. Из-за офлайн-доступа и кэширования все эти метрики резко уходят в “зелёную зону”. А это — плюс в ранжировании (подробнее здесь).
Инструменты: как проверять PWA на SEO-пригодность
Каждую неделю начинаю с Lighthouse. Это как пульс сайта. Показывает не только SEO и UX, но и доступность, производительность. Даёт рекомендации: что править, что ускорить.
Дополнительно использую Google PageSpeed Insights — особенно для анализа мобильной версии. И ещё WebPageTest — там видно, что реально происходит на секундной шкале. А для архитектуры сайта — Screaming Frog. Он подсвечивает дубли, цепочки редиректов, неиндексируемые страницы.
Без этих инструментов — как с завязанными глазами.
Crawl budget: как не сжечь ресурс поисковых систем
У крупных проектов есть одна проблема: боты не бесконечные. У них есть лимит. Это и есть crawl budget.
Чтобы им правильно управлять:
- удаляем дубли и ставим им noindex;
- прописываем robots.txt — и не слишком щедро;
- оптимизируем карту сайта, чтобы были только важные страницы;
- следим за временем отклика и ошибками на сервере.
У нас в агентстве был кейс: крупный новостник в СНГ сократил количество URL в sitemap с 300 тыс. до 60 тыс. Индексация выросла, важные страницы начали ранжироваться, трафик пошёл вверх. Иногда меньше — значит лучше.
Вместо вывода
PWA — это не просто тренд. Это инструмент. Я сама видела, как они меняют восприятие сайта, ускоряют работу, и, что самое главное — улучшают SEO.
Не раз убеждалась: вложиться в архитектуру, настроить SSR, проработать кэш — и сайт начинает “дышать”. Люди остаются дольше, возвращаются — и приводят новых.
Если вы ещё раздумываете, надо ли связываться с PWA — спросите себя: хочу ли я, чтобы мой сайт был первым в поиске? Ответ будет не про технологии — а про отношение к своему проекту.
Хотите быть в курсе последних новостей о бизнесе? Подпишитесь на наш Telegram-канал сюда
Посмотреть наш календарь мероприятий можно здесь

